Police Log: July 5, 2009



PERSONAL-INJURY ACCIDENT
MORRISONVILLE — Seven people, including several children and a pregnant woman, were taken to the hospital following a three-vehicle accident on Route 374 Friday evening.

Plattsburgh-based State Police said Mason Taylor was stopped on Rand Hill Road around 5:45 p.m. when he attempted to cross the state roadway and collided with Ronald Dubrey's van, which was eastbound.

The crash sent Taylor's car spinning into Carol Dominy's truck, which was stopped at the nearby stop sign.

Police said the accident left Dominy, 44, of Morrisonville with a minor arm injury and sent the passengers in Dubrey's vehicle to the hospital for precautionary evaluation.

Dubrey, 37, of Plattsburgh was not injured.

Taylor, 17, of Plattsburgh, whose young passenger was also evaluated for precautionary reasons, was later ticketed for failing to keep right.

All three vehicles were towed.

FELONY ARREST
NORTH ELBA — A Lake Placid man was charged with felony driving while intoxicated Friday after a traffic stop.

Ray Brook-based State Police said Lance Larose was driving on Sentinal Avenue around 11:20 p.m. when troopers spotted him allegedly swerving onto the shoulder of the road.

After initiating a traffic stop, police allegedly found the 23-year-old man intoxicated and driving without a license.

He was charged with two felony DWI offenses and first-degree aggravated unlicensed operation of a motor vehicle.

Larose was also cited for a license-plate violation, failing to keep right and driving on the shoulder.

He will reappear in court at a later date to face the charges.
